I need some pro comments on tire Fitment
Hi I have a second gen GS, my friend gave me a pair of tires for the 18" g-spyder that I just bought, they are 255/45/18 , the side wall is slightly bigger than the recommanded 245/40/18.
Then I saw a pair of 245/40/18 tires on sale on craigslist so I was going to grab it so I have a whole set.
now the questions are :
1. Will the 255/45/18 tires fit the back with stock height?
2. Does it matter the back is higher than the front ? ( sidewall ) will it bring any side effect like worse mpg ?
3. Should I just find a matching size pair instead ? ( make it 255/45/18 all around )
Thanks !

although the 255/45's will fit, they will be a little more than 1" taller than stock... This can affect the speedometer, traction control, and ABS systems, if equipped. It may change fuel mileage, though you probably wouldn't notice it (the new mileage would be calculated on an incorrect speedometer and odometer). Your tire sizes on a normal RWD vehicle should be within 3% diameter all the way around... That difference between 255/45 and 245/40 is 5%, which is quite high.
It can be done, but I wouldn't recommend it... and 255/45-18 would be a tight fit up front anyways...
